Microsoft Windows Setup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ability - CVE-2019-1316ID: oval:org.secpod.oval:def:58927 | Date: (C)2019-10-09 (M)2024-03-06 |

An elevation of privilege vulnerability exists in Microsoft Windows Setup when it does not properly handle privileges. An attacker who successfully exploited this vulnerability could run processes in an elevated context. An attacker could then install programs; view, change or delete data.To exploit this vulnerability, an attacker would first have to log on to the system. An attacker could then run a specially crafted application that could exploit the vulnerability and take control of an affected system.The security update addresses the vulnerability by enabling Windows Setup to properly handle user privileges.
